
Federal prosecutors to get classified House documents in Brennan probe as decision on charges against former CIA chief nears

“The House Intelligence Committee voted Tuesday to give federal prosecutors classified records related to John Brennan, according to a committee spokesperson, signaling the Justice Department’s investigation into the former CIA director may be heading towards possible charges”
